How they compare

WB: East Asia & Pacific (ida & Ibrd) currently reports 0.2571 % change on previous year against -1.56 % change on previous year in Denmark, a difference of 1.82 % change on previous year.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 21 shared years of data; in 1986 it was WB: East Asia & Pacific (ida & Ibrd) ahead.

Denmark ranks 157th and WB: East Asia & Pacific (ida & Ibrd) ranks 159th of 213 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Denmark averaged higher in 3 and WB: East Asia & Pacific (ida & Ibrd) in 2.
